Electron Multiplying Charge-Coupled Device (EMCCD) Cameras Market Overview

EMCCD cameras overcome a fundamental physical constraint to deliver high sensitivity with high speed. Traditional CCD cameras offered high sensitivity, with readout noises in single figure <10e- but at the expense of slow readout. Hence, they were often referred to as slow scan cameras.

Electron Multiplying Charge-Coupled Device (EMCCD) Cameras Market Analysis:

The global Electron Multiplying Charge-Coupled Device (EMCCD) Cameras Market size was estimated at USD 120 million in 2023 and is projected to reach USD 267.15 million by 2032, exhibiting a CAGR of 9.30% during the forecast period.

North America Electron Multiplying Charge-Coupled Device (EMCCD) Cameras market size was estimated at USD 36.45 million in 2023, at a CAGR of 7.97% during the forecast period of 2025 through 2032.

Market Drivers

  • High Demand for Low-Light Imaging Solutions
    EMCCD cameras are widely used in applications requiring extreme sensitivity, such as astronomy, biomedical imaging, and surveillance.

  • Rising Adoption in Healthcare & Scientific Research
    The growing use of EMCCD cameras in life sciences and medical imaging is significantly contributing to market expansion.

  • Technological Advancements in Imaging Sensors
    Innovations in electron multiplication technology are improving image quality, driving greater adoption across various industries.


Market Restraints

  • High Cost of EMCCD Cameras
    The advanced technology used in EMCCD cameras makes them expensive, limiting their adoption, especially in budget-constrained industries.

  • Competition from Emerging Imaging Technologies
    The rising popularity of CMOS and sCMOS sensors is creating competitive pressure on EMCCD cameras.

  • Limited Awareness in Developing Regions
    Many potential users in emerging markets lack awareness of EMCCD technology, slowing its growth in these regions.


Market Opportunities

  • Expansion in Security & Defense Applications
    The increasing need for night vision and surveillance solutions is creating new growth opportunities for EMCCD cameras.

  • Growing Demand in Space & Astronomy Research
    Space agencies and research institutions are investing in advanced imaging solutions, fueling demand for EMCCD cameras.

  • Integration with AI & Machine Learning
    The combination of EMCCD technology with AI-driven image processing is expected to open new possibilities in industrial and scientific applications.


Market Challenges

  • High Power Consumption & Heat Generation
    EMCCD cameras require efficient cooling mechanisms, which can add to operational costs and complexity.

  • Limited Manufacturers & Supply Chain Constraints
    The market is dominated by a few key players, leading to supply chain vulnerabilities and limited availability.

  • Regulatory Compliance & Quality Standards
    Stringent industry regulations for imaging devices pose challenges for manufacturers in terms of product approval and certification.
